Handover — Vexler partner SFTP drop

Ownership moves to you today. Drop runs hourly from Vexler's end into the intake bucket via the relay host. Watch for zero-byte files; their exporter flakes on Mondays. Creds live in the ops vault, path noted in the runbook. Vault auto-seals after 48h idle. Support escalations go to the on-call rotation, not me. If the vault is sealed when you need it, unseal with the recovery passphrase below.

recovery phrase for tadug-fafof: zorwyn-kasion

# Break-Glass: Catalog Cache Invalidation

Scope: the Pinrow product catalog at Veldstone Retail. If stale prices persist after a purge and the Hollowmere invalidation queue is wedged, use break-glass to flush the edge tier directly. Contractors: get verbal sign-off from the catalog lead first. Steps: open the Hollowmere admin shell, select emergency-flush, confirm the tenant, and run it once — repeated flushes thrash the origin. Access is logged and expires after 20 minutes. Unseal the admin shell with the passphrase below.

recovery phrase for kahop-tajog: istix-casvan

Subject: SQL lint cut-over complete

Team — the migration to the new Sievewright linting rules for SQL files finished last night ahead of the weekly sync. All 412 files in the warehouse repo now pass; the remaining eleven legacy views carry explicit suppression comments with tracked tickets. CI rejects non-compliant files as of this morning, and the pre-commit hook mirrors the server-side checks exactly. Local setups must be updated to stay in step. The linter now runs with the configuration below.

settings of fafog-haduf:
ZORIX_PIN=4648
ZORIX_METRICS_HOST=metrics.zorix.paliqsys.corp
ZORIX_LOG_LEVEL=info
ZORIX_TENANT=druix

Capacity note for the weekly sync: Hollowmere's cold-storage archiver is projected to hit its nightly window ceiling by Q3 given current bucket growth. Raising batch size and parallel workers buys roughly four months, at the cost of higher peak egress. Proposed adjustments below; please review before Thursday. The revised tuning constants are as follows.

limits module of kahag-fajop:
QUOTAS = {
    "wenwyn": 10,
    "zorath": 1,
}